    Sulfur dioxide is a by-product of many processes, both natural and human-made. Massive amounts of this are released during volcanic eruptions such as the one seen above on the Big Island (Hawaii). Humans produce sulfur dioxide by burning coal. The gas has a cooling effect when in the atmosphere by reflecting sunlight back away from the earth. However, sulfur dioxide is also a component of smog and rain, both of which are harmful to . Many efforts have been made to reduce SO 2 levels to lower acid rain production. An unforeseen complication: as we lower the of this gas in the atmosphere, we lower its ability to cool and then we have global warming concerns.

    Mole Fraction
    ::分子分数

    One way to express relative amounts of substances in a is with the mole fraction. Mole fraction   ( X ) is the ratio of moles of one substance in a mixture to the total number of moles of all substances. For a mixture of two substances,  A and B , the mole fractions of each would be written as follows:

    X A = mol   A mol   A + mol   B and X B = mol   B mol   A + mol   B

    If a mixture consists of 0.50 mol  A and 1.00 mol B , then the mole fraction of  A would be X A = 0.5 1.5 = 0.33 .  Similarly, the mole fraction of  B would be X B = 1.0 1.5 = 0.67 .

    Mole fraction is a useful quantity for analyzing gas mixtures in conjunction with Dalton’s law of partial pressures . Consider the following situation: A 20.0 liter vessel contains 1.0 mol of hydrogen gas at a pressure of 600 mmHg. Another 20.0 liter vessel contains 3.0 mol of helium at a pressure of 1800 mmHg. These two gases are mixed together in an identical 20.0 liter vessel. Because each will exert its own pressure according to Dalton’s law , we can express the partial pressures as follows:

    P H 2 = X H 2 × P Total and P H e = X H e × P Total

    The partial pressure of a gas in a mixture is equal to its mole fraction multiplied by the total pressure. For our mixture of hydrogen and helium:

    X H 2 = 1.0   mol 1.0   mol + 3.0   mol = 0.25 and X H e = 3.0   mol 1.0   mol + 3.0   mol = 0.75

    The total pressure according to Dalton’s law is 600  mmHg + 1800  mmHg = 2400  mmHg . So, each partial pressure will be:

    P H 2 = 0.25 × 2400  mmHg = 600  mmHg P H e = 0.75 × 2400  mmHg = 1800  mmHg

    The partial pressures of each gas in the mixture don’t change since they were mixed into the same size vessel and the temperature was not changed.
